Pearl Academy discusses Indian art
Pearl Academy of Fashion, a leading fashion and design education institute in India, organized conference to discuss the condition of Indian craftsmanship and artisans here recently.
The conference was attended by personalities from various fields like retail, fair Trade, NGOs and media & design enterprises. They participated and shared their knowledge in the field during the conference.
Gillian Rowe, Aditi Shah Aman, Mala Pradeep Sinha, Villoo Mirza, Vikram Joshi, Jatin Bhatt, Meera Goradia, Gurpreet Sindhu and Ms Kusum Tiwari attended the comference.
Kshitij Padeya, MD, Eco Tasar Silk Pvt Ltd. who came with more “modern” approach of crafts business and talked about the pragmatic ways to bring the depleting art into the mainstream industry.
